New England..
Morning water vapor imagery shows a belt of 80+ knot mid level winds
nosing from eastern Ontario into Quebec, with mid-level height falls
and large-scale forcing spreading into northern New England. This
has been aiding in multiple rounds of intense thunderstorms over
Quebec this morning, but so far this activity has struggled to make
it into the US due to a more stable air mass. This will change
through the day as a moist and moderately unstable air mass advects
eastward into parts of New England ahead of the primary convective
activity. Widespread smoke from upstream fires will also somewhat
limit daytime heating today, although the extent of the cooling is
uncertain.
Present indications are that several convective cells and clusters
will track southeastward across parts of eastern NY, VT/NH and
western ME later this afternoon and evening. Forecast soundings in
this region show favorable CAPE/shear combinations for supercell
storms capable of damaging winds, large hail, and a few tornadoes.
Larger bowing clusters may also evolve, with a greater risk of
damaging winds. This activity may persist after midnight with a
continued severe risk.
